1937 Print Great Depression William Houck Davis Natchez Mississippi Adams FZ3 XGI8 Tsar Alexander IThis is an original 1937 halftone print portrait of William Davis of Natchez, Mississippi. The caption writes, "Sharecropper. Pays one fourth, owns own mules. Wife and child away. Begging for work, extremely poor. In cupboard had only hunk of salt pork" This image was taken to demonstrate the number of unemployed people in the United States during the late 1930s. Photography by William G.
